The main idea of this study is to measure and analyse land subsidence in Bandung City by processing SENTINEL 1A satellite images using the PS-InSAR technique. PS-InSAR technique is an effective technique for measuring crustal deformation. We processed 7 pair imageries of SENTINEL 1A images (at level 1.0) acquired from September 2014 to 2017. For time series of interferogram analyse, we analysed 7 pairs possibility of PS-InSAR interferogram using SNAP open source program. To get better result, we computed the best baseline estimation to reduce fringes from baseline between master and slave data. The 1-arcsec (30 m) Shuttle Radar Topography Mission (SRTM) used to remove the topographic contribution as Digital Elevation Model (DEM) reference. Whereas for observing land subsidence using the PS-InSAR method. Overlapping method was used to correlate the effect of changes in land subsidence into land use region in Semarang City. Observations in the deep aquifer used correlation seen from the increase and decrease of the graph of the inner MAT aquifer and the average increase and decrease in ground surface of PS-InSAR. The result of PS- InSAR processing showed the average value of the decrease in the face of the soil with a range of -4.4 ± 3.4 cm up. +2, 2 ± 3, 4 cm and from result of processing got information of the biggest decrease in land surface is in Sub District Semarang Utara, Semarang Barat, Pedurungan and Genuk. To verify the result of PS-InSAR results, we used secondary data GPS observation[6] in 2013 and 2016 with a 3 observation benchmark points. … (more)
